This recipe for chocolate bacon cupcakes is just delicious. If you like chocolate and bacon, you'll love these! It also has some coffee in it, so it's just yummy!
Author: Mom 'N Daughter Savings
Recipe type: Dessert
Serves: 24
Ingredients
- 12 Slices Bacon
- 2 C All Purpose Flour
- ¾ C and 1 Tablesp Unsweetened Cocoa Powder
- 2 C Sugar
- 2 teasp Baking Soda
- 1 teasp Baking Powder
- ½ teasp Salt
- 2 Eggs
- 1 C Strongly Brewed Coffee, cold
- 1 C Buttermilk
- ½ C Vegetable Oil
Instructions
- Preheat your overn to 375
- Line cupcake pan (Makes 24)
- Bake the Bacon until crispy, done. then crumble it up into really small pieces.
- Stir in a bowl, Flour, ¾ C of the Cocoa Powder, Sugar, Baking Soda, Baking Powder and Salt
- Push to the sides, making a well, and add in Eggs, Coffee, Buttermilk, and Oil. Stir just until blended.
- Mix in ¾ of the Bacon, Keep the rest for Garnish.
- Spoon into cupcake liners.
- Bake for 20 - 25 minutes, Until top springs back
- Cool Completely
- Frost with Chocolate Icing
- Garnish with the rest of the Cocoa Powder and small pieces of bacon.
